class=\"elementor-widget-container\">\n\t\t\t\t\t\t\t\t\t<p>El <strong>Laboratorio de Qu\u00edmica Anal\u00edtica (LabQA)<\/strong> est\u00e1 equipado con un autoanalizador de flujo continuo modelo FUTURA de ALLIANCE INSTRUMENTS, un analizador TOC-L con m\u00f3dulo TNM-L para TOC de SHIMADZU, y un cromat\u00f3grafo i\u00f3nico para an\u00e1lisis de iones mayoritarios de METROHM.<\/p><p>El FUTURA de Alianza est\u00e1 preparado para analizar la concentraci\u00f3n de nutrientes inorg\u00e1nicos disueltos (Nitrato, Nitrito, Amonio, Fosfato, Silicato).<\/p><p>El TOC-TN de Shimadzu est\u00e1 preparado para analizar la concentraci\u00f3n de carbono org\u00e1nico total (TOC), carbono org\u00e1nico no purgable (NPOC) y nitr\u00f3geno total (TN).<\/p><p>El cromat\u00f3grafo i\u00f3nico de Metrohm est\u00e1 preparado para analizar la concentraci\u00f3n de cationes (Calcio, Sodio, Magnesio, Amonio, Potasio) y aniones mayoritarios (Fluorur, Bromuro, Cloruro, Nitrato, Nitrito, Fosfato, y Sulfato).<\/p><p>Los tres sistemas est\u00e1n listos para muestras l\u00edquidas. data-widget_type=\"text-editor.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t\t\t\t\t<p>Los nitratos se reducen a nitritos mediante Vanadi (III) cloruro. Los nitritos reaccionan con la sulfanilamida en condiciones \u00e1cidas para dar un diazocompuesto. con N-(1-Naftil)etilendiamina, la mezcla pasa a ser un compuesto de color rosa. La densidad \u00f3ptica es medida a una longitud de onda de 520\/540nm.<\/p>\t\t\t\t\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-2ac575e elementor-widget__width-initial elementor-widget elementor-widget-text-editor\" data-id=\"2ac575e\" data-element_type=\"widget\" data-widget_type=\"text-editor.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t\t\t\t\t<p>Referencia: Doane TA and Horwath WR. 2003. <em>Spectrophotometric determination of nitrate with a single reagent<\/em>. Analytical Letters 36(12):2713-2722; Miranda KM, Espey MG, Wink DA. 2001.\u00a0<em>A rapid, simple spectrophotometric method for simultaneous detection of nitrate and nitrite<\/em>. Nitric Oxide: Biology and Chemistry 5(1):62-71.)<\/p>\t\t\t\t\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t<div data-dce-background-color=\"#FFFFFF\" class=\"elementor-element elementor-element-0ac3441 e-con-full e-flex e-con e-child\" data-id=\"0ac3441\" data-element_type=\"container\" data-settings=\"{&quot;background_background&quot;:&quot;classic&quot;}\">\n\t\t\t\t<div class=\"elementor-element elementor-element-6242ba3 elementor-widget elementor-widget-heading\" data-id=\"6242ba3\" data-element_type=\"widget\" data-widget_type=\"heading.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t<h3 class=\"elementor-heading-title elementor-size-default\">FOSFATOS<\/h3>\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-9710f18 elementor-widget__width-initial elementor-widget elementor-widget-text-editor\" data-id=\"9710f18\" data-element_type=\"widget\" data-widget_type=\"text-editor.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t\t\t\t\t<p>El heptamollibdato de amonio reacciona con el ortofosfato en condiciones \u00e1cidas para formar el \u00e1cido fosfomol\u00edbdico. Esta mezcla se reduce a azul de molibdeno con \u00e1cido asc\u00f3rbico. La reacci\u00f3n se cataliza con tartrato de antimonio y potasio. La densidad \u00f3ptica es medida a una longitud de onda de 880nm.<\/p>\t\t\t\t\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-774fd60 elementor-widget__width-initial elementor-widget elementor-widget-text-editor\" data-id=\"774fd60\" data-element_type=\"widget\" data-widget_type=\"text-editor.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t\t\t\t\t<p>Referencia: Grasshoff K, Kremling, K, Ehrhardt M. 1999. <em>Methods of Seawater Analysis<\/em>. 3<sup>rd<\/sup>\u00a0revised and extended edition. Wiley, Weinheim, Germany.<\/p>\t\t\t\t\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t<div data-dce-background-color=\"#FFFFFF\" class=\"elementor-element elementor-element-35f707d e-con-full e-flex e-con e-child\" data-id=\"35f707d\" data-element_type=\"container\" data-settings=\"{&quot;background_background&quot;:&quot;classic&quot;}\">\n\t\t\t\t<div class=\"elementor-element elementor-element-4bd1e02 elementor-widget elementor-widget-heading\" data-id=\"4bd1e02\" data-element_type=\"widget\" data-widget_type=\"heading.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t<h3 class=\"elementor-heading-title elementor-size-default\">AMONIO<\/h3>\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-555ac15 elementor-widget__width-initial elementor-widget elementor-widget-text-editor\" data-id=\"555ac15\" data-element_type=\"widget\" data-widget_type=\"text-editor.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t\t\t\t\t<p>El m\u00e9todo se basa en la reacci\u00f3n del amonio con ftaldialdeh\u00eddo (OPA) en presencia de sulfito a 70\u00baC. El complejo resultante viaja a trav\u00e9s de un detector equipado con una l\u00e1mpara negra de fluorescencia, que excita el complejo a 370nm y registra la emisi\u00f3n resultante a 460nm.<\/p>\t\t\t\t\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-8ac5847 elementor-widget__width-initial elementor-widget elementor-widget-text-editor\" data-id=\"8ac5847\" data-element_type=\"widget\" data-widget_type=\"text-editor.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t\t\t\t\t<p>Referencia: K\u00e9rouel R and Aminot A. 1997. <em>Fluorometric determination of ammonia in sea and estuarine waters by direct segmented flow analysis.<\/em>\u00a0Marine Chemistry 57: 265-275.<\/p>\t\t\t\t\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t<div data-dce-background-color=\"#FFFFFF\" class=\"elementor-element elementor-element-9694903 e-con-full e-flex e-con e-child\" data-id=\"9694903\" data-element_type=\"container\" data-settings=\"{&quot;background_background&quot;:&quot;classic&quot;}\">\n\t\t\t\t<div class=\"elementor-element elementor-element-956e61e elementor-widget elementor-widget-heading\" data-id=\"956e61e\" data-element_type=\"widget\" data-widget_type=\"heading.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t<h3 class=\"elementor-heading-title elementor-size-default\">NITRITOS<\/h3>\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-9622822 elementor-widget__width-initial elementor-widget elementor-widget-text-editor\" data-id=\"9622822\" data-element_type=\"widget\" data-widget_type=\"text-editor.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t\t\t\t\t<p>Los nitritos reaccionan con sulfanilamida en condiciones \u00e1cidas para dar un diazocompuesto. Con N-(1-Naftil)etilendiamina, se forma un compuesto ros\u00e1ceo. La densidad \u00f3ptica es medida a una longitud de onda de 520\/540nm.<\/p>\t\t\t\t\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-8ece1f6 elementor-widget__width-initial elementor-widget elementor-widget-text-editor\" data-id=\"8ece1f6\" data-element_type=\"widget\" data-widget_type=\"text-editor.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t\t\t\t\t<p>Referencia: Grasshoff K, Kremling, K, Ehrhardt M. 1999. <em>Methods of Seawater Analysis<\/em>. 3<sup>rd<\/sup>\u00a0revised and extended edition. Wiley, Weinheim, Germany.<\/p>\t\t\t\t\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t<div data-dce-background-color=\"#FFFFFF\" class=\"elementor-element elementor-element-2d99bdb e-con-full e-flex e-con e-child\" data-id=\"2d99bdb\" data-element_type=\"container\" data-settings=\"{&quot;background_background&quot;:&quot;classic&quot;}\">\n\t\t\t\t<div class=\"elementor-element elementor-element-1359a0a elementor-widget elementor-widget-heading\" data-id=\"1359a0a\" data-element_type=\"widget\" data-widget_type=\"heading.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t<h3 class=\"elementor-heading-title elementor-size-default\">SILICATOS<\/h3>\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-70007bb elementor-widget__width-initial elementor-widget elementor-widget-text-editor\" data-id=\"70007bb\" data-element_type=\"widget\" data-widget_type=\"text-editor.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t\t\t\t\t<p>El silicato reacciona con molibdato en condiciones \u00e1cidas(1&lt;pH&lt;2) para formar un complejo cuando el ratio Si:Mo es 1:12. \u00c9ste se reduce con \u00e1cido asc\u00f3rbico para formar un compuesto de color azul medido a 810nm. Se a\u00f1ade \u00e1cido ox\u00e1lico para evitar interferencias provocadas por el complejo fosfomol\u00edbdico.<\/p>\t\t\t\t\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-6ce46cd elementor-widget__width-initial elementor-widget elementor-widget-text-editor\" data-id=\"6ce46cd\" data-element_type=\"widget\" data-widget_type=\"text-editor.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t\t\t\t\t<p>Referencia: Grasshoff K, Kremling, K, Ehrhardt M. 1999.\u00a0<em>Methods of Seawater Analysis<\/em>. 3<sup>rd<\/sup>\u00a0revised and extended edition. Wiley, Weinheim, Germany.<\/p>\t\t\t\t\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t<div data-dce-background-color=\"#FFFFFF\" class=\"elementor-element elementor-element-e0e2ab6 e-con-full e-flex e-con e-child\" data-id=\"e0e2ab6\" data-element_type=\"container\" data-settings=\"{&quot;background_background&quot;:&quot;classic&quot;}\">\n\t\t\t\t<div class=\"elementor-element elementor-element-354cf13 elementor-widget elementor-widget-heading\" data-id=\"354cf13\" data-element_type=\"widget\" data-widget_type=\"heading.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t<h3 class=\"elementor-heading-title elementor-size-default\">CARBONO ORG\u00c1NICO TOTAL<\/h3>\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-7236098 elementor-widget__width-initial elementor-widget elementor-widget-text-editor\" data-id=\"7236098\" data-element_type=\"widget\" data-widget_type=\"text-editor.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t\t\t\t\t<p>La muestra l\u00edquida est\u00e1 sometida a combusti\u00f3n oxidativa a alta temperatura (680\u00baC) despu\u00e9s de eliminar el carbono inorg\u00e1nico mediante acidificaci\u00f3n.<\/p>\t\t\t\t\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-6a5f20c elementor-widget__width-initial elementor-widget elementor-widget-text-editor\" data-id=\"6a5f20c\" data-element_type=\"widget\" data-widget_type=\"text-editor.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t\t\t\t\t<p>Referencia: \u00c1lvarez-Salgado X and Miller AEJ.1998.\u00a0<em>Simultaneous determination of dissolved organic carbon and total dissolved nitrogen in seawater by high temperature catalytic oxidation: conditions for accurate shipboard measurements.<\/em>\u00a0Marine Chemistry 62: 325\u2013333.<\/p>\t\t\t\t\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t<div data-dce-background-color=\"#FFFFFF\" class=\"elementor-element elementor-element-561c12b e-con-full e-flex e-con e-child\" data-id=\"561c12b\" data-element_type=\"container\" data-settings=\"{&quot;background_background&quot;:&quot;classic&quot;}\">\n\t\t\t\t<div class=\"elementor-element elementor-element-52bc9ac elementor-widget elementor-widget-heading\" data-id=\"52bc9ac\" data-element_type=\"widget\" data-widget_type=\"heading.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t<h3 class=\"elementor-heading-title elementor-size-default\">NITR\u00d3GENO TOTAL<\/h3>\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-7f8bd0c elementor-widget__width-initial elementor-widget elementor-widget-text-editor\" data-id=\"7f8bd0c\" data-element_type=\"widget\" data-widget_type=\"text-editor.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t\t\t\t\t<p>La muestra l\u00edquida es sometida a pir\u00f3lisis oxidativa (720\u00baC) y el \u00f3xido n\u00edtrico resultante, despu\u00e9s de entrar en contacto con O3, pasa a N2O, emitiendo posteriormente un fot\u00f3n que es detectado por quimioluminiscencia.<\/p>\t\t\t\t\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-b002645 elementor-widget__width-initial elementor-widget elementor-widget-text-editor\" data-id=\"b002645\" data-element_type=\"widget\" data-widget_type=\"text-editor.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t\t\t\t\t<p>Referencia: \u00c1lvarez-Salgado X and Miller AEJ.1998.\u00a0<em>Simultaneous determination of dissolved organic carbon and total dissolved nitrogen in seawater by high temperature catalytic oxidation: conditions for accurate shipboard measurements.<\/em>\u00a0Marine Chemistry 62: 325\u2013333.<\/p>\t\t\t\t\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t<div data-dce-background-color=\"#FFFFFF\" class=\"elementor-element elementor-element-3bac5be e-con-full e-flex e-con e-child\" data-id=\"3bac5be\" data-element_type=\"container\" data-settings=\"{&quot;background_background&quot;:&quot;classic&quot;}\">\n\t\t\t\t<div class=\"elementor-element elementor-element-a550c65 elementor-widget elementor-widget-heading\" data-id=\"a550c65\" data-element_type=\"widget\" data-widget_type=\"heading.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t<h3 class=\"elementor-heading-title elementor-size-default\">IONES MAYORITARIOS<\/h3>\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-9d0fe43 elementor-widget__width-initial elementor-widget elementor-widget-text-editor\" data-id=\"9d0fe43\" data-element_type=\"widget\" data-widget_type=\"text-editor.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t\t\t\t\t<p>La cromatograf\u00eda i\u00f3nica permite el an\u00e1lisis de aniones y cationes solubles en muestras acuosas. Los iones se separan mediante intercambio i\u00f3nico entre la fase m\u00f3vil y la estacionaria (columna). Los iones quedan retenidos en la columna en funci\u00f3n de su carga, son detectados secuencialmente por un detector de conductividad y registrados en un cromatograma, que representa la intensidad de la se\u00f1al de cada ion seg\u00fan su tiempo de retenci\u00f3n.<\/p>\t\t\t\t\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-d8a1b0f elementor-widget__width-initial elementor-widget elementor-widget-text-editor\" data-id=\"d8a1b0f\" data-element_type=\"widget\" data-widget_type=\"text-editor.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t\t\t\t\t<p>Referencia: Haddad, P.R., and Jackson, P.E. 1990.
